New Buick, BMW PHEVs for China

Green Car Congress

Buick announced that it will shortly launch the Velite 5, its first extended range electric vehicle (EREV), in China. EDI offering Class 3 plug-in hybrid utility truck

Green Car Congress

EDI) announced the availability of a Class 3 utility truck based upon its plug-in hybrid (PHEV) drivetrain that reduces emissions and fuel use by up to 80%. The vehicle, based upon a Chevy Silverado 3500 Class 3 commercial fleet truck, is the only Class 3 commercial work truck that has 30-40 miles (48-64 km) of all-electric range, EDI says.
